Skip to content

Commit 83f3fc0

Browse files
committed
test: Remove dev-dependency insta
Our (few) snapshot tests don't need the infrastructure `insta` offers. changelog: ignore
1 parent da8436e commit 83f3fc0

3 files changed

Lines changed: 6 additions & 9 deletions

File tree

twenty-first/Cargo.toml

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-19,7 +19,6 @@ categories = ["cryptography", "mathematics"]
1919
blake3 = "1.5.5"
2020
bincode = "1.3.3"
2121
criterion = { version = "0.6", features = ["html_reports"] }
22-
insta = "1.42"
2322
proptest = "1.6"
2423
proptest-arbitrary-interop = "0.1"
2524
test-strategy = "0.4"

twenty-first/src/math/tip5.rs

Lines changed: 2 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-735,7 +735,6 @@ pub(crate) mod tip5_tests {
735735
use std::hash::Hash;
736736
use std::ops::Mul;
737737

738-
use insta::assert_snapshot;
739738
use prop::sample::size_range;
740739
use proptest::prelude::*;
741740
use proptest_arbitrary_interop::arb;
@@ -1147,11 +1146,11 @@ pub(crate) mod tip5_tests {
11471146
}
11481147

11491148
#[test]
1150-
fn tip5_hasher_trait_test() {
1149+
fn tip5_hasher_trait_snapshot_test() {
11511150
let mut hasher = Tip5::init();
11521151
let data = b"hello world";
11531152
hasher.write(data);
1154-
assert_snapshot!(hasher.finish(), @"2267905471610932299");
1153+
assert_eq!(hasher.finish(), 2267905471610932299);
11551154
}
11561155

11571156
#[proptest]

twenty-first/src/util_types/mmr/mmr_accumulator.rs

Lines changed: 4 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-549,7 +549,6 @@ impl<'a> Arbitrary<'a> for MmrAccumulator {
549549
mod accumulator_mmr_tests {
550550
use std::cmp;
551551

552-
use insta::assert_snapshot;
553552
use itertools::Itertools;
554553
use itertools::izip;
555554
use num_traits::ConstZero;
@@ -1032,16 +1031,16 @@ mod accumulator_mmr_tests {
10321031
let mut rng = StdRng::seed_from_u64(0x92ca758afeec6d29);
10331032

10341033
let empty_mmr = MmrAccumulator::new_from_leafs(vec![]);
1035-
assert_snapshot!(empty_mmr.bag_peaks().0[0], @"00941080798860502477");
1034+
assert_eq!(empty_mmr.bag_peaks().0[0].value(), 00941080798860502477);
10361035

10371036
let one_leaf_mmr = MmrAccumulator::new_from_leafs(vec![rng.random()]);
1038-
assert_snapshot!(one_leaf_mmr.bag_peaks().0[0], @"16030278140236594076");
1037+
assert_eq!(one_leaf_mmr.bag_peaks().0[0].value(), 16030278140236594076);
10391038

10401039
let two_leafs_mmr = MmrAccumulator::new_from_leafs(vec![rng.random()]);
1041-
assert_snapshot!(two_leafs_mmr.bag_peaks().0[0], @"09405464453414142998");
1040+
assert_eq!(two_leafs_mmr.bag_peaks().0[0].value(), 09405464453414142998);
10421041

10431042
let ten_peaks: [Digest; 10] = rng.random();
10441043
let ten_peak_mmr = MmrAccumulator::init(ten_peaks.to_vec(), 0b11_1111_1111);
1045-
assert_snapshot!(ten_peak_mmr.bag_peaks().0[0], @"03780783030734820370");
1044+
assert_eq!(ten_peak_mmr.bag_peaks().0[0].value(), 03780783030734820370);
10461045
}
10471046
}

0 commit comments

Comments
 (0)